Palo Alto (US): Chile captain Claudio Bravo says Lionel Messi's fitness will have no bearing on how the Copa America champions prepare for Tuesday's heavyweight showdown against Argentina in Santa Clara.

Bravo's Barcelona teammate Messi is uncertain to line up for Argentina as he struggles back to fitness after suffering a back injury in a friendly against Honduras.

However Bravo said regardless of whether Messi plays or not, it will not affect Chile's approach to a game that is a rematch of last year's Copa America final in Santiago won by the hosts.

"Whether Leo does or doesn't play, nothing is going to change our football," goalkeeper Bravo told reporters.

"Personally, I'd prefer it if he plays because he brings a lot to a game. Knowing Leo, he will want to play, particularly this game, because it's the first match of the tournament. "But we're not going to change the way we play, we will do what we've always done," Bravo added.
